The colours on our plate are more than just aesthetic—it is a unique combination of nutrients and protective plant compounds called phytonutrients. From radiant reds to lush greens and deep purples, every colour offers something special.

Ever wondered why red fruits and veggies pop in your grocery basket?

 

Nature has infused them with lycopene and anthocyanin, which makes them pop and provides health benefits. Lycopene keeps your heart happy and reduces risk of cancer. Anthocyanin fights inflammation and boosts your brain health.

Let’s get into orange foods - that warm tone is beta carotene which upgrades into Vitamin A - all about sharp vision, glowing skin and supporting immune warriors.

Colour yellow is bright, uplifting and buzzing with energy. These foods are packed with lutein, zeaxanthin, and some beta-carotene. They act like natural sunglasses to your eyes, fights inflammation and maintains healthy skin.

Then comes green, full of potential, growth, and energy – loaded with lutein, zeaxanthin, chlorophyll and glucosinolates. Greens help your body detox, support eye health, and some even strengthen your bones with calcium.

The deep blues and purples in your diet come packed with anthocyanins. These powerful antioxidants help extend your youthfulness, keeps your heart happy and brain sharper, fight inflammation.

While white foods may not be flashy, they do boost our immune system and has anti-bacterial properties due to their sulphur and flavonoid compounds.

Now that we have uncovered the benefits, should we stick to just one colour on our plate for maximum health benefits?

Always remember, no single colour provides everything your body needs. That’s why eating a wide range of colourful produce ensures you are getting a balanced mix of vitamins, antioxidants, and other health-promoting compounds.
